                                    @Grubstake: Thanks. I have tried to follow "NRF24L01+ Radio" pin out connection. I have double / triple check my wiring is correct. But I still get the same fail message in mysgw debug mode:

                                    [root@alarmpi bin]# ./mysgw -d
                                    mysgw: Starting gateway...
                                    mysgw: Protocol version - 2.1.1
                                    mysgw: MCO:BGN:INIT GW,CP=RNNG---,VER=2.1.1
                                    mysgw: TSM:INIT
                                    mysgw: TSF:WUR:MS=0
                                    mysgw: !TSM:INIT:TSP FAIL
                                    mysgw: TSM:FAIL:CNT=1
                                    mysgw: TSM:FAIL:PDT
                                    mysgw: TSM:FAIL:RE-INIT
                                    mysgw: TSM:INIT
                                    mysgw: !TSM:INIT:TSP FAIL
                                    mysgw: TSM:FAIL:CNT=2
                                    mysgw: TSM:FAIL:PDT
                                    mysgw: TSM:FAIL:RE-INIT
                                    mysgw: TSM:INIT
                                    mysgw: !TSM:INIT:TSP FAIL
                                    mysgw: TSM:FAIL:CNT=3
                                    mysgw: TSM:FAIL:PDT
                                    mysgw: Received SIGINT

                                    I finally find out my raspberry pi board isn't detected properly in configure. I change the function detect_machine:

                                    function detect_machine {
                                    ...
                                        case $hardware in
                                    ...
                                        BCM2835)
                                            soc="BCM2835"
                                            if [[ $machine == "Raspberry"* ]]; then
                                                local rev=($(detect_rpi_revision))
                                                if [[ $rev == "a02082" || $rev == "a22082" ]]; then
                                                    tp="RPi3"
                                                else
                                                    tp="Rpi2"
                                                fi
                                            fi
                                            ;;
                                    ...
                                    

                                    make mysgw again, and I get this finally:

                                    # ./mysgw -d
                                    mysgw: Starting gateway...
                                    mysgw: Protocol version - 2.1.1
                                    mysgw: MCO:BGN:INIT GW,CP=RNNG---,VER=2.1.1
                                    mysgw: TSF:LRT:OK
                                    mysgw: TSM:INIT
                                    mysgw: TSF:WUR:MS=0
                                    mysgw: TSM:INIT:TSP OK
                                    mysgw: TSM:INIT:GW MODE
                                    mysgw: TSM:READY:ID=0,PAR=0,DIS=0
                                    mysgw: MCO:REG:NOT NEEDED
                                    mysgw: Listening for connections on 0.0.0.0:5003
                                    mysgw: MCO:BGN:STP
                                    mysgw: MCO:BGN:INIT OK,TSP=1

                                        I followed the instructions carefully. However I get an error. Can someone help?

                                        git clone https://github.com/mysensors/MySensors.git --branch master
                                        cd MySensors
                                        ./configure --my-transport=nrf24 --my-gateway=ethernet
                                        

                                        This results in a warning:

                                        [SECTION] Detecting SPI driver.
                                          [WARNING] No supported SPI driver detected.
                                        

                                        When I run make I get the follwing error:

                                        In file included from examples_linux/mysgw.cpp:74:0:
                                        ./MySensors.h:254:2: error: #error No support for nRF24 radio on this platform
                                         #error No support for nRF24 radio on this platform
                                          ^
                                        In file included from ./drivers/RF24/RF24.cpp:23:0,
                                                         from ./MySensors.h:290,
                                                         from examples_linux/mysgw.cpp:74:
                                        ./drivers/RF24/RF24.h:52:17: fatal error: SPI.h: No such file or directory
                                         #include <SPI.h>
                                                         ^
                                        compilation terminated.
                                        Makefile:114: recipe for target 'build/examples_linux/mysgw.o' failed
                                        make: *** [build/examples_linux/mysgw.o] Error 1
                                        

                                        Hope someone can help. Thanks.

                                          Maybe you didn't enable SPI on the pi.

                                          From command prompt type 'sudo raspi-config', then select option 5 from the menu. This takes you to where you can enable the SPI bus on the pi. Then try again.
